“As a Heart Attack Survivor, I Know I Was Given This Opportunity To Give Back.”

alanna-hayley-main580
While your day may not always go according to plan, you know that one thing’s for sure – the minute you step into a Flywheel stadium, the instructor’s positivity and endless energy will take your mind off of everything else. A force of both inner and outer strength, the instructor often leaves us thinking, “how the hell do they do that?” Flywheel Philadelphia instructor Alanna Gardner’s past answers this very question. Alanna has overcome obstacles that many women her age couldn’t begin to imagine. A rare and undetected birth defect led to a massive heart attack that almost took her life at age 25. Rather than letting this sideline her, she was determined to fight through and become an athlete once again. With regained strength and a relentless spirit, Alanna not only challenges her riders, but encourages them to celebrate all that their bodies are capable of. Read her amazing story here.

On a typical day, FlyBarre Seattle instructor Sarah Lustbader might teach class, zip off to a dance rehearsal, jump over to her office job and finally head home to bury her nose in accounting books. Her week is sprinkled with dance and yoga classes, walks around her favorite lake and studying or making playlists at coffee shops. Still, she loves to spend part of her day at the Barre, inspiring her clients to seize the moment and leave all their worries on the mat. As a professional dancer, Sarah has learned to juggle her schedule while always striving for balance.
